## Step 4 — Configure the renderer

The Inkwell invoice renderer converts billing records to PDF via the Folio engine. When reviewing a deploy PR, check that RENDER_DPI is 150, FONT_DIR points at the bundled fonts, and INVOICE_LOCALE matches the tenant region. Output lands in the path given by PDF_OUT_DIR; the worker will not create it, so confirm the provisioning script does. The renderer also watermarks each PDF with a signed stamp, and the stamping secret is set on the line directly below.

vault entry, yahif-yajep: COURIER_KEY29=b802bdf8034096b65a51c6ba5abe2

## Support

So something in HoistLab is acting up — maybe the dispatch replay drifts, or the car-arrival stats look off. First, check the FAQ in `docs/faq.md`; about half the tickets we get are the known nondeterminism-with-custom-seeds thing. Second, grab the sim version and the scenario file, because we'll ask for both every single time. Logs from `hoistlab --verbose` help a lot too. Once you've got that bundle together, send it our way.

escalation mailbox, kagep-tawef: ulawyn_norius_gordor@paliqlabs.corp

09:14 — The Givenbrook donation-receipt mailer began duplicating receipts for recurring donors. Plugin authors: the retry hook fired even on successful sends, so any plugin registering post-send callbacks saw each donation twice. The dedupe guard shipped at 10:02. Verify your handlers are idempotent against the patched build, identified by the token below.

pipeline stamp: htk3_69f

### Audit Item 7: tailcat CLI

Verify that the internal log-tailing CLI `tailcat` enforces read-only scoped tokens, redacts payload fields flagged as sensitive, and rotates its session cache every 24 hours. Confirm the audit log records every tail session, including filters applied. Evidence: config snapshot plus last week's session ledger. This item cannot close without written confirmation from the accountable engineer.

account owner for kafop-haweg: Pelax Gilael Istir